The Mexico Gamma Knife market is experiencing steady growth due to the increasing prevalence of brain tumors and neurological disorders in the country. The demand for non-invasive and precise treatment options is driving the adoption of Gamma Knife technology among healthcare providers and patients. Advancements in Gamma Knife systems, such as improved imaging capabilities and treatment planning software, are further fueling market expansion. Additionally, rising healthcare expenditure, growing awareness about the benefits of radiosurgery, and a supportive regulatory environment are contributing to the market`s growth. Key players in the Mexico Gamma Knife market include Elekta AB and Accuray Incorporated, who are focusing on technological innovations and strategic partnerships to enhance their market presence and cater to the evolving healthcare needs of the Mexican population.

In the Mexico Gamma Knife market, some challenges that are commonly faced include limited awareness among healthcare providers and patients about the benefits and availability of Gamma Knife technology for treating various neurological conditions. Additionally, the high initial cost of acquiring and installing Gamma Knife systems can be a barrier for healthcare facilities looking to adopt this technology. Another challenge is the lack of reimbursement policies or inadequate insurance coverage for Gamma Knife procedures, which can limit patient access to this advanced treatment option. Furthermore, competition from alternative treatment modalities and technologies in the field of neurosurgery presents a challenge for Gamma Knife providers in Mexico. Overcoming these challenges will require targeted education and awareness campaigns, strategic partnerships, and advocacy efforts to improve reimbursement policies and increase market penetration.

Government policies related to the Mexico Gamma Knife Market primarily revolve around regulations set by the Federal Commission for Protection against Sanitary Risks (COFEPRIS). COFEPRIS oversees the approval process for medical devices, including Gamma Knife systems, ensuring they meet safety and efficacy standards before entering the market. Additionally, the Mexican government has implemented healthcare reforms to improve access to advanced medical technologies, such as Gamma Knife radiosurgery, for its citizens. These policies aim to regulate the quality of healthcare services provided in Mexico and promote the use of innovative treatments like Gamma Knife technology in the country`s healthcare system.
